Role Overview
Your focus as a Care Assistant will be to deliver high standards of personal care, contributing fully to the care team to ensure continuity of services to residents.
Responsibilities
* Assisting residents with all personal hygiene care to ensure optimum independence, dignity, and respect.
* Recognising and understanding clinical risk areas such as weight loss, pressure sores, risk of falls, and signs of infections, and escalating any identified risks in a timely manner.
* Acting courteously towards residents and their visitors, respecting the dignity and individuality of each resident.
* Practising safe systems of work across the range of tasks.
